Output c24e67f4a2a5a107b9ff96bac476b8b691dcf17f959eeb080e9dc8aae7fc8f6b:0

value
154650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ab51b431da3b392fdcd535f90665f584418f31e OP_EQUAL
address
32fddxjhVC4SNzj4MMs6KaAV5cWxTnvjrH
transaction
c24e67f4a2a5a107b9ff96bac476b8b691dcf17f959eeb080e9dc8aae7fc8f6b
confirmations
252292
spent
true